How they compare
El Salvador currently reports 3.5% against 3.4% in Colombia, a difference of 0.1%.
That makes El Salvador's figure about 1.1 times Colombia's.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 25 shared years of data; in 1970 it was El Salvador ahead.
Colombia ranks 53rd and El Salvador ranks 52nd of 181 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Colombia averaged higher in 3 and El Salvador in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Colombia | El Salvador |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 11.0% | 6.7% | 4.3% | Colombia |
| 1980s | 7.8% | 5.0% | 2.8% | Colombia |
| 1990s | 4.6% | 4.1% | 0.5% | Colombia |
| 2000s | 2.3% | 3.8% | 1.5% | El Salvador |
| 2010s | 1.5% | 3.2% | 1.8% | El Salvador |
| 2020s | 3.0% | 3.4% | 0.4% | El Salvador |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
